Translation1d Class
Represents a 1D translation.
Features
Create a
Translation1dobject from meters, centimeters, inches, or feet using thefrom_<unit>class methods. This is the most explicit and least error-prone way to use the class.Add or subtract two
Translation1dobjects.Multiply or divide a
Translation1dobject by a scalar.Check equality between two
Translation1dobjects.Convert the magnitude to meters, centimeters, inches, or feet.
Calculate the inverse of a
Translation1dobject.
Examples
Create a Translation1d object from different units
from VEXLib.Geometry.Translation1d import Translation1d
translation_meters = Translation1d.from_meters(5)
print(translation_meters) # Output: 5m
translation_centimeters = Translation1d.from_centimeters(500)
print(translation_centimeters) # Output: 5m
translation_inches = Translation1d.from_inches(196.85)
print(translation_inches) # Output: 5m
translation_feet = Translation1d.from_feet(16.4042)
print(translation_feet) # Output: 5m
Add two Translation1d objects
sum_translation = translation_meters + translation_centimeters
print(sum_translation) # Output: 10m
Subtract two Translation1d objects
difference_translation = translation_meters - translation_centimeters
print(difference_translation) # Output: 0m
Multiply a Translation1d object by a scalar
scaled_translation = translation_meters * 2
print(scaled_translation) # Output: 10m
Divide a Translation1d object by a scalar
divided_translation = translation_meters / 2
print(divided_translation) # Output: 2.5m
Check equality between two Translation1d objects
are_equal = translation_meters == translation_centimeters
print(are_equal) # Output: True
Convert the magnitude to different units
print(translation_meters.to_centimeters()) # Output: 500.0
print(translation_meters.to_inches()) # Output: 196.8503937007874
print(translation_meters.to_feet()) # Output: 16.404199475065616
Calculate the inverse of a Translation1d object
inverse_translation = translation_meters.inverse()
print(inverse_translation) # Output: -5m
